Rabdosia excisa (Maxim.) Kudo, which had been proved had the anti-tumor activity, is a plant of the Labiatae. It is not only widely used in the folk, but also has been developed into all sorts of health care, medical products to enter the market. There are about150species are widely distributed in the world, the latest survey claimed that about115species were found in China, including25varieties. Rabdosia excisia (Maxim.) kudo is a perennial plant, its root is semi-lignified. It is widely distributed in China, it could be found in many places. It mainly distributed in Jilin province, Liaoning province and other northeast areas, as well as the Henan province. While in the foreign countries, it mainly distributed in the far areas of Asia, such as, Japan, North Korea and Russia. It has been more than100years since the Japanese researchers studied the chemical constituents of the Rabdosia species. Due to the chemical constituents of ent-Kaurane had been proved to be of the anti-tumor activity, more and more researchers in the world began to pay much attention to this specie. The main purpose of this thesis is to find a complete, economic, and practical set about the extraction, isolation, purification and structure identification of natural products. Based on this condition, we aim to finger out the chemical constituents of flowers and fruits of Rabdosia excisa, explore new leading compounds of anti-humor activity,and provided the reliable reference data for the later researchers.Medicinal plant Rabdosia excisa was widely used in folk as the treatment of red swollen and ulcer when it was used in the outer, while used in the inner, it was used to cure the sore throat, cteric model hepatitis and other symptoms. The pharmacology study of Rabdosia excisa involved almost every systerm of the body. The study of biological activity showed that it had the effect of anti-tumor, anti-bacterial, anti-inflammatory. It also can affect the people embryo cells in the brain infection of herpes simplex cytotoxic change, the inhibition liver cancer cell proliferation, influence prostate cancer cell cycle, affect the immune function, improve the myocardial blood flow, resistance of lipid peroxidation damage, etc. Due to the different parts of Rabdosia excisa in the different region, different time will produce different secondary metabolites, we collected the flower and fruits of Rabdosia excisa in August2010in Henan province and study the chemical composition. Dried flowers and fruits of Rabdosia excisa shattered, the portion was extracted by ethyl ether, decolored by the activated carbon, the ethyl ether portion was isolated and purified by column chromato-graphy, including silica gel and recrystallization, etc. Seventeen compounds were obtained, including ten diterpenoids, five triterpenoids and two steroids from the ethyl ether soluble portion. These compounds were identified by modern spectroscopic technology, such as1H-NMR13C-NMR, MS, IR, etc. They were respectively elucidated as:the Epinodosin (Ⅰ); Lasiokaourin (Ⅱ); Kamebacetal A (Ⅲ); Epinodosinol (Ⅳ); Ursolic acid (Ⅴ); Oridonin (Ⅵ); β-sitosterol (Ⅶ);2α-Hydroxy-ursolic acid (Ⅷ); maslinic acid (Ⅸ); Rabdesinate (Ⅹ); Maoyecrystal E (Ⅺ); Enmenol-glucoside (Ⅻ); macrocalyxin G(ⅩⅢ),; Rabdosichuanin C (ⅩⅣ); Hyptadienic acid (ⅩⅤ);2α,3α,19-Trihydroxyur s-12-en-28-oic acid (ⅩⅥ); daucosterol (ⅩⅦ).The compounds Ⅰ, Ⅱ, Ⅳ, Ⅷ, Ⅸ, Ⅹ, Ⅺ, Ⅻ, ⅩⅢ, ⅩⅣ, ⅩⅤ, ⅩⅥ were found in Rabdosia excisa for the first time.This paper has four chapters. The first one is a introduction about current research status of Rabdosia species, summarized the pharmacognosy characteristic of Rabdosia excisa, the origin of the distribution center and the chemical components and pharmacological effects of Rabdosia species in recent40years. The second chapter summaried the characteristics of Rabdosia excisa mainly through accessing to the domestic and foreign literatures. It also included the previous researches about the chemical constituents and biological activity of Rabdosia. The third chapter showed the procedures of extraction and purification of ethyl ether soluble portion. The fourth chapter gave the spectral data (1H-NMR、13C-NMR、IR、MS)and elucidated the structures of the seventeen compounds.
